 Pixar announces new Finding Nemo short film, Loving Dory  Pixar is returning to the “Finding Nemo” universe with a new short film titled “Loving Dory,” continuing the franchise after its two films grossed roughly $2 billion worldwide. The short was announced at the Annecy International Animation Film Festival, where Pixar also revealed plot details and screened early footage. Produced by Mary Alice Drumm and directed by Lou Hamou-Lhadj, the story follows Dory as she takes Nemo to school. On her way back, she becomes trapped in a sea anemone and is rescued by what she believes is a jellyfish, which is actually a plastic bag containing a discarded sunscreen tube. Dory then forms an unexpected friendship with the object, with the footage showing a series of whimsical, emotional moments between the pair. FAMOUS YOUTUBER AND BJP LEADER MANISH KASHYAP WAS ALLEGEDLY ASSAULTED BY JUNIOR DOCTORS AT PATNA MEDICAL COLLEGE AND HOSPITAL (PMCH) ON MONDAY. (PHOTO).


 Famous YouTuber and BJP leader Manish Kashyap was allegedly assaulted by junior doctors at Patna Medical College and Hospital (PMCH) on Monday. 

Kashyap had gone to the hospital in the afternoon to help a patient when he got into a dispute with a female junior doctor. The argument reportedly turned serious when Kashyap started recording videos inside the hospital premises.


According to sources, the junior doctors were angered by Kashyap’s behavior towards their female colleague. In response, they allegedly locked him in a room for nearly three hours and beat him. Later, Kashyap posted photos of himself on social media from a hospital bed, claiming he was injured and receiving treatment.


While the doctors accuse Kashyap of misbehaving with a female doctor, his supporters say he was unfairly held and assaulted. Adding confusion to the incident, an associate of Kashyap later claimed that no such altercation took place at all and denied any wrongdoing.


Pirbahor Police Station in-charge Abdul Haleem confirmed that police intervened in the matter. He said that both sides had resolved the issue among themselves and no official complaint was filed by either party.
